MSI GF65 Gaming Laptop | vs | HP Victus Gaming Laptop |
---|---|---|
Jan 26th, 2021 | Release Date | Unknown |
Core i7-10750H | CPU | Ryzen 7 5800H |
GeForce RTX 3060 Mobile | GPU | GeForce RTX 3050 Mobile |
16 GB | RAM | 32 GB |
512 GB SSD | Storage | 1 TB SSD |
1920x1080 | Resolution | 1920x1080 |
144 Hz | Refresh Rate | 144 Hz |
15.6" | Screen Size | 15.6" |
